S41 Bipolar Hall Effect Position Sensor, housed in the compact TO-92S package, offers a reliable and precise solution for magnetic switching and sensing applications. Unlike unipolar sensors, this device operates using a bipolar magnetic field, requiring both a North and South pole field to cycle the output between ON and OFF states. This feature provides superior noise immunity and precise position sensing, making it an excellent component for detecting rotor rotation, speed, and positioning in various electromechanical systems. You can easily integrate this low-power sensor into battery-operated systems and demanding industrial controls where accurate, contactless switching is essential for long-term reliability.

Key Features:
  • Bipolar Latching: The sensor requires an alternating North ($B_{\text{RP}}$) and South ($B_{\text{OP}}$) magnetic field to toggle its output state, significantly enhancing switching precision and stability in rotational or reciprocating motion systems.
  • Solid-State Reliability: As a contactless device, it eliminates mechanical wear, offering virtually unlimited operating life and high immunity to dust, moisture, and vibration.
  • High Sensitivity: It detects small changes in magnetic flux density, a crucial factor allowing you to utilize smaller, less costly magnets or achieve greater air gaps between the sensor and the magnet.
  • Wide Operating Voltage Range: Functions efficiently across a broad power supply range, typically 4.5 V to 24 V DC, readily accommodating various microcontrollers and industrial logic voltages.
  • Miniaturized Package (TO-92S): The small footprint and slim profile make this a superior component for space-constrained product designs where a traditional TO-92 would be too large.
Technical Specifications:
  • Output Type: Open-Collector (NPN), which requires a pull-up resistor. This design allows the output to interface with various logic levels.
  • Operating Voltage (VCC): 4.5 V to 24 V DC (Typical range).
  • Output Sink Current (IOUT): 20 mA maximum (Can directly drive LEDs or small loads).
  • Magnetic Flux Density (Operating Point BOP): Typically +5 mT (South pole).
  • Magnetic Flux Density (Release Point BRP): Typically −5 mT (North pole).
  • Switching Hysteresis (BHYS): An integrated hysteresis loop ensures clean, bounce-free switching.

Pinout and Wiring:
  • Pin 1 (VCC): Connect this pin to the positive power supply (4.5 V to 24 V).
  • Pin 2 (GND): Connect this pin to ground (0 V).
  • Pin 3 (Output): Connect this pin to your load (e.g., microcontroller input or LED) using a pull-up resistor to VCC. The output switches LOW (to ground) when activated by a magnetic field.
  • Wiring Note: Always utilize a small pull-up resistor (e.g., 10 kΩ to 1 kΩ) between the Output pin and VCC for the open-collector output to function correctly.

Equivalent Models:
  • SS41F: A very common and comparable bipolar latching sensor often used in magnetic field sensing applications.
  • A1203/A1204: Bipolar latching Hall-effect switches known for their stable performance and wide temperature range.
  • US5881: Another popular bipolar sensor model providing robust operation in the automotive and industrial sectors.
  • OH3144: While unipolar, this model is frequently cross-referenced, but requires only a South pole to turn ON and removal of the magnet to turn OFF.
